To run Tiles of War smoothly, an entry-level GPU like the GTX 1650 or RX 6500 XT is recommended for minimum settings. This game is designed to be accessible, making it suitable for a wide range of hardware configurations. For a more enjoyable experience, especially in competitive multiplayer, aiming for a mid-range card such as the RTX 3060 or RX 6600 will allow you to play at 1080p with higher settings, delivering better visuals and smoother gameplay.
If you're using a higher-end GPU, such as an RTX 3060 Ti or RX 6700 XT, you can push to 1440p with high settings, taking full advantage of the game’s tactical visuals and detailed maps. As Tiles of War emphasizes strategic gameplay over intense graphics, even modest systems should perform adequately, but investing in a decent GPU will enhance your overall experience.
